Use Painless Security signing key
[freeradius.git] / debian / freeradius-config.postrm
1 #! /bin/sh
2
3 set -e
4
5 case "$1" in
6         remove)
7                 ;;
8         purge)
9                 # Remove dangling links from sites-enabled.
10                 for link in /etc/freeradius/sites-enabled/*; do
11                         if [ -L "$link" ] && [ ! -e "$link" ]; then
12                                 rm -f "$link"
13                         fi
14                 done
15
16                 # Remove dangling links from mods-enabled.
17                 for link in /etc/freeradius/mods-enabled/*; do
18                         if [ -L "$link" ] && [ ! -e "$link" ]; then
19                                 rm -f "$link"
20                         fi
21                 done
22
23                 if dpkg-statoverride --list | grep -qw /etc/freeradius/dictionary$; then
24                         dpkg-statoverride --remove /etc/freeradius/dictionary
25                 fi
26
27                 if dpkg-statoverride --list | grep -qw /etc/freeradius/radiusd.conf$; then
28                         dpkg-statoverride --remove /etc/freeradius/radiusd.conf
29                 fi
30
31                 if dpkg-statoverride --list | grep -qw /etc/freeradius$; then
32                         dpkg-statoverride --remove /etc/freeradius
33                 fi
34
35                 rmdir --ignore-fail-on-non-empty /etc/freeradius
36                 ;;
37         *)
38                 ;;
39 esac
40
41 #DEBHELPER#
42
43 exit 0
44